C 语言结构体详解


当前第2页 返回上一页

2、在声明的同时定义变量:

1

2

3

4

5

struct UDP_Server_Thread_Para

{

    void *pData;

    int Len;

}UDPThreadPara1,UDPThreadPara2;

声明和定义变量放在一起比较直观,但是没法用这种方式重新定义新的结构体变量,而且在比较大的代码工程中,为了使程序结构清晰,会对类型声明和变量定义放在不同的位置。

3、不指定类型名直接定义结构体类型变量:

1

2

3

4

5

struct

{

    void *pData;

    int Len;

}UDPThreadPara1,UDPThreadPara2;

推荐教程:《PHP》《C#》

以上就是C 语言结构体详解的详细内容!

返回前面的内容

相关阅读 >>

c++11新特性 - 多态和虚函数,override说明符

c语言中double是什么意思?

“->” 在 c 语言什么意思?

c 语言和 c++ 有什么区别

c 语言怎么实现三个数大小排序

c中fork()和exec()之间的区别是什么?fork()和exec()的简单比较

c语言中fputc函数的用法

c语言交换两个数的值

c 语言中 fun 函数怎么用?

c ++中accessor函数的特征

更多相关阅读请进入《c》频道 >>



打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...